Abstract

The invention discloses a kind of implantation methods of strawberry, comprise the steps of:(a) planting site is selected;(b) soil ferments;(c) ridge is done;(d) Strawberry Seedlings are chosen;(e) Strawberry Seedlings are colonized;(f) final-period management:Top dressing, irrigation, temperature control;(g) pollinate;(h) plucked after fruit maturation.This invention simplifies each plantation step, labor intensity is alleviated, is easy to manage, easy to implement and popularization, and strawberry sick rate is low, also improves the yield and quality of strawberry, improves economic benefit.

Description

A kind of strawberry cultivation method
Technical field
The present invention relates to a kind of strawberry cultivation method, belongs to strawberry cultivating technical field.
Background technology
The nutrition-allocated proportion of strawberry is quite reasonable, wherein ascorbic content is approximately the 10 of the watermelon of equivalent, grape or apple Times, the pectin and cellulose contained in strawberry, it can promote rich in iron, fructose, glucose, citric acid, malic acid etc. in strawberry in addition Enter gastrointestinal peristalsis, improve constipation, prevent the generation of hemorrhoid, intestinal cancer.Market remains high always to the demand of strawberry, but strawberry gives birth to Occurs disease certain kind of berries increasing proportion in production, yield reduction, deformed fruit, listing is slower, the trend such as economic benefit declines, its main cause High-quality strawberry cultivating technology is a lack of, causes the accumulation of the disease certain kind of berries serious, multiple fertilizing, watering is needed during strawberry cultivating, is also increased Labor intensity is added.
The content of the invention
The technical problems to be solved by the invention are the defects of overcoming prior art, there is provided a kind of strawberry cultivation method, it It is easy to manage, implements, and strawberry sick rate is low, also improves the yield and quality of strawberry, improves economic benefit.
In order to solve the above-mentioned technical problem, the technical scheme is that:A kind of strawberry cultivation method, include following step Suddenly:
(a) planting site is selected:Select ground even, the loam that the soil is porous, irrigation and drainage are convenient, illumination is good or sandy loam conduct Planting site;
(b) soil ferments:By planting site deep plough and loam is smashed, cultivation depth is 25-30cm, then by farm manure, Cake fertilizer, urea are well mixed with the loam, after pouring water, are tightly covered with film 30~35 days;
(c) ridge is done:Take film off, treat that soil air-dries, play multiple ridges, multiple ridges are set parallel, 0.8~1.2m of row spacing, ridge Deep 0.3~0.4m, 0.4~0.6m of adjacent ridge spacing;
(d) Strawberry Seedlings are chosen:It is sturdy to choose rhizome, the fertile Strawberry Seedlings of leaf;
(e) Strawberry Seedlings are colonized:Longitudinal direction of the Strawberry Seedlings along ridge is colonized, the distance between adjacent Strawberry Seedlings for 0.25~ 0.35m, water is poured after field planting;
(f) final-period management:
(f1) top dressing:Once-combined fertilizer is applied after Strawberry Seedlings field planting within every 20~30 days, and the weight of the composite fertilizer applied every time is 20~30kg/ mus;
(f2) irrigate:Irrigate once within every 6~10 days after Strawberry Seedlings field planting;
(f3) temperature control:When outside air temperature is 10~12 degree, mulch film is completed, and mulch film is torn at the seedling heart of Strawberry Seedlings, Strawberry Seedlings are pulled, and Strawberry Seedlings are organized into original state;When outside air temperature is at 4~5 degree, first-class greenhouse outer membrane;Work as outside air temperature During less than 0 degree, first-class greenhouse inner membrance;
(g) pollinate:When strawberry blooms, divulged information toward greenhouse is interior, to pollinate, and be put into honeybee supple-mentary pollination;
(h) plucked after fruit maturation.
Further, the cake fertilizer includes at least one of soya-bean cake, rape cake, peanut cake.
Further, farm manure described in step (b), cake fertilizer and weight of urea are respectively farm manure:300~400kg/ Mu, cake fertilizer:100~200kg/ mus, urea:5~10kg/ mus.
Further, in order to prevent Strawberry Seedlings from carrying disease and strengthen the disease-resistant performance of Strawberry Seedlings, step (d) and step (e) Described in Strawberry Seedlings be virus-free strawberry seedling.
Strawberry is irrigated further for convenient, drip irrigation is equipped with along low-lying place of the longitudinal direction on the ridge between adjacent ridge Band, the drip irrigation zone are provided with hole at strawberry field planting, and Strawberry Seedlings are irrigated with will pass through irrigation belt.
Further, composite fertilizer is dissolved in water during top dressing in step (f1), be made 2%~3% concentration composite fertilizer it is water-soluble Liquid, the aqueous solution of composite fertilizer is then passed through drip irrigation zone, Strawberry Seedlings applied fertilizer by the drip irrigation hole of drip irrigation zone.
Further, the greenhouse outer membrane in step (f3) is plastic sheeting, and greenhouse inner membrance is plastic cloth.
Further for bud differentiation is promoted, fruit-setting rate is improved, also leaf is dredged comprising step (f4) in step (f):In strawberry Seedling plucks yellow old leaf, sick leaf, stolon and grows weak lateral bud before blooming, to concentrate nutrition.
Further, between step (g) and (h), also comprising flower and fruit thinning:Remove the bad flower of unnecessary either appearance or Fruit, to concentrate nutrient and to reduce malformed fruit rate.
After employing above-mentioned technical proposal, the Strawberry Seedlings that the present invention selects are virus-free strawberry seedling, can prevent Strawberry Seedlings from carrying Disease and the disease-resistant performance for strengthening Strawberry Seedlings;Before being colonized Strawberry Seedlings, fermentation process is carried out to soil, the performance of fertility can be easy to, Also soil is disinfected, more conducively the growth of Strawberry Seedlings;Drip irrigation zone is laid in planting site, is easy to enter Strawberry Seedlings Row is irrigated and top dressing, reduces labor intensity;Increase mulch film, greenhouse outer membrane, greenhouse inner membrance when temperature is low, play insulation temperature control Purpose, strawberry of being more convenient for healthily grows;Using leaf, flower thinning, fruit thinning is dredged in final-period management, it is easy to the concentration of nutrition, carries High fruit-setting rate, also improve the conversion ratio of fertility.This invention simplifies each plantation step, labor intensity is alleviated, is easy to manage, Easy to implement and popularization, and strawberry sick rate is low, also improves the yield and quality of strawberry, improves economic benefit.
